Tacitus. 275-276 AD. Billon Tetradrachm, 8.21g (11h). Alexandria. Obv: A K KΛ TAKI - TOC CEB Bust laureate, draped, cuirassed right, seen from front. Rx: ETOVC - A Athena seated left on throne with back leg in form of lion's leg, holding Nike and scepter, shield with pelleted border and facing Medusa head in center leans against throne. Cologne 3114. Dattari 5514. BMC 2402. Oxford 4488. EF
